WebMar 20, 2024 · Biofilm delays wound healing. In a diabetic mouse model with P. aeruginosa biofilm Zhao et al 19 demonstrated delay in wound healing when compared with the control mice group without biofilm. The wounds with biofilm had thick epidermis and dermis, poorly vascularised matrix and showed evidence of delayed epithelialization. ... WebMinicircle-VEGF165 DNA (20 μg) delivery via sonoporation improved wound healing compared to the null plasmid control diabetic mouse treatment group in a full thickness excisional wound model . Wound closure was significantly improved at day six after wounding, almost to the same level as non-diabetic mice controls.
